Story
OdPpF1b.jpg

In the year 2022 the nations changed and shifted much like the daily struggle of the skies and earth. On both sides -- The New world order led by the united states and the Global Freedom Force led by Russia had tore at the countries around them some time before one finally declaring war against the other. It is unclear who started the war, but the lands getting publicly ravaged by the Nations stubborn attacks are Canada, China, and Europe in-between. The pressure from the 4 continents collide left Africa with few battle scars, Australia and Antarctica with a 0 immigration policy. Europe countries of Blue and Red seemed to have evacuated all their citizens from the cross fire -- yet the same kindness was not offered to the neutral areas in Europe; France, Ukraine, Belarus, Bulgaria and Portugal. Which remained on their own accord to defend themselves and their land from either side. The same is true for Central America and most of Middle Africa.

The brutal warfare spanned from dog fights with drones to defensive tactical nuclear warfare-- Yet the soldiers fighting were not skimped of their share of battle equipment. A thick hearty armor encased all of the soldiers on both sides. Those who had thrown away their humanity and become androids for the purpose of battle. The suits and modified bodies withstood most treacherous tasks for men of any size, being able to lift heavy weapons with ease and calculate equations close to that of dedicated computers. Technology took a bleak turn in the wrong direction once more. As manufactures produced for the only purpose of hate, spite and greed. Each side was just as unbearable to look at then the other-- both sides had truly given up the hope of their citizens and the beauty of the land that they scarred everyday. The conflict has pushed scientists in Neutral zones to defend their research and hold out on their own terms.

Yet, there were men who wished for the true wonders of nature and the advanced scientific mind of humans and the potential of their creations could be preserved. In Marseilles, France-- A doctor especially guilty of abandoning his country for this purpose was Dr.Jour, The head of Horizon Corporation (of) Intellectual Minds. Both the New World and Freedom Force knew of Dr.Jour and his experts in metaphysical cyber metamorphosis. His close friends knew his passion of the youth and how he could make them smile. His purpose, he believed-- was to open the eyes of the people who fought each other. Dr.Jour's carefree and peaceful banter was an insult to the minds that craved his research and technology. Both forces had readily approached Dr.Jour's estate and attempted to kidnap him for their own uses of cyber space warfare -- both sides had been cursed to find not the doctor, but each other. The warfare that opened over Marseilles was great and terrible- Leaving the Doctors compound and the surrounding area bitter with the rattle of gun fire and the collapsing of buildings.

As the two sides pushed deeper into France, Toulouse, Bordeaux and Montpelier would be captured by the Freedom force where Marseilles, Lyon, Lorraine and the Champagne Ardenne would be on the verge of capture from the New World. France was being eaten alive- And Dr.Jour knew this all to to well. Dr.Jour had planned around this event and escaped to the heart of France, Paris. The Doctor's research had fell onto sacred territory that no other human knew possible. He had engineered an invention to protect France and bring change to stop the war. His passion was so intense-- The man sacrificed himself to jump start the great cataclysm of the invention. His brilliant mind had found a way to render to flesh and bone the characters of warring video games -- Those used to the conflict that plaques the world-- and have them fight to extinguish the ill minds in the world that wish other people to suffer. Within a matter of seconds the ground shook-- The Horizon Headquarters quaking in a belligerent jest to match the struggles on the ground - A loud ring to emulate the deafening of the horrors of those in the air - paired with a flash of bright light and a physical force that would punish the soldiers of both sides outside the borders of France.

Soldiers would be flung from the heart of France towards the out borders, and those at the epicenter were certain dead if their landing was solid. A dim light would breach upwards in a dome around France and protect it from the entrance of either side. All naturally born French citizens would be unfazed, and look up towards the dome in the sky that kept them safe as a cradle. The Technological mind of Dr.Jour had created a barrier that, with cyber space and data, brought to life various characters from Video games inside of the barrier. Soldiers on the outside look inward and squint their eyes, the bright light fading only to reveal that France had remained untouched and reinforced by strange soldiers from another world. Ones that could easily and quickly chop threw the men's bulky armor and ones that flung fire at insane degrees to protect the borders of France. The characters and the french citizens grew to a quick liking to each other -- The french seeing it only fit that the characters be allies as opposed to shunned from France.

Very soon after these events-- More characters had seeped threw-- The population of France grew small amounts from the surrounding nations Ukraine, Belarus, Bulgaria and Portugal as the force field seemed to welcome and warm these neutral areas as well. France has become the last frontier of Europe's Neutrality front and has also become the city with the most aggression towards because of the other worldly characters from inside. Seemingly, Characters are free to enter and leave the force field as if they were neutrality citizens-- and all the characters seem to appear inside the Horizon Headquarters Top floor Starbucks where Dr.Jour had been in his last moments.

It has been 3 months since these events and there has been a change of events from most of the african neutral areas as well as Australia. It seems Australia has opened their ports for only official french crafts and mobiles to enter. Neutral counties of Middle Africa have risked their resources and greatest minds to get both into france's safe borders. Leaving the Two Sides in drastically heated combat focused in the neutral territories. The only fabric of legacy left behind by Dr.Jour was his research in bulk. The aggression against the Neutral areas of Europe have because of Dr.Jour's ultimatum; With only his assistants left to deal with the characters and any further action. The assistants ultimately decided they need to get a team of characters together, sneak into the other 4 European neutral countries and spark hope within their society to pull together an empire!

NPC Character of Choice: Shiranui

Game of Origin: Ōkami

Power: Shiranui has the power of the Thirteen Brush Techniques.

Weapons: Celestial Brush, Truth Mirror

Weaknesses: Darkness, him being a Sun God.

Appearance: Shiranui is a vast white wolf with very pronounced crimson markings and black eyes. It is clear that he is very agile and strong. A mane of white light surrounds Shiranui, making him appear ancient. His tail is dipped in black ink, appearing as a caligraphy brush (and also how he uses the Celestial Brush). The Truth Mirror, one of the most advanced Divine Instruments, floats on his back, giving him a very ethereal look.

Link to Picture; [x]

Personality: Shiranui does not speak, but rather the Poncle Ishaku, his Celestial Envoy, speaks for him. He is benevolent and kind-hearted, helping out anyone in need. Although he is loyal to his friends, Shiranui has a short attention span, and may fall asleep if an explanation is too long, or if he's heard it already. He is very smart, much like his reincarnation Ōkami Amaterasu. Proof ofthis is being able to detect a demon easily, if it is hiding inside another usually peaceful entity.

Morality: Good

Biography: 100 years ago when the ceremony to sacrifice a maiden to Orochi drew near, a white wolf was seen roaming around the village at night. The villagers, thinking the wolf as a familiar of Orochi, named the wolf "Shiranui". Because the villagers thought Shiranui to be a familiar of Orochi, a man named Nagi attempted to challenge it, but the wolf would use its swift movements to escape from him every time.

On the night of the festival, when it was discovered that Nagi's beloved, Nami, was to be sacrificed to Orochi, Nagi disguised himself as Nami to gain access to and slay Orochi. However, his attempts seemed to be in vain because of Orochi's steel-hard hide. During their battle, Nagi was brutally injured. Just before the fatal blow was to be dealt to Nagi, Shiranui arrived and stepped in to battle Orochi.

After hours of fighting, Shiranui received many wounds and was about to lose the battle. When the final blow was about to be struck, Shiranui lifted its head and howled, summoning the moon, which gave Nagi new strength that helped him defeat and seal Orochi. Even though the battle was won, it came at a price. Shiranui had been poisoned by Orochi's deadly claws during the battle and was slowly, but surely, dying. Nagi carried Shiranui back to the village where the wolf quietly passed away. The villagers built a shrine on the resting grounds in honor of Shiranui's brave deeds. Back to present time, Shiranui was reborn, and thus now roams in search of more demons to vanquish in the land of mortals.

Traumas: Shiranui has occasional flashbacks to his battle with Orochi, and becomes very wary of everything around him, falsely believing has been sent into the past once more.

NPC Character of Choice: Patchouli Knowledge

Game of Origin: Touhou Project

Power: Patchouli Knowledge is exceptionally gifted in the arcane arts, casting and wielding high level signs and enchantments with ease. She has a particular affinity for elemental magic, often utilizing signs that align within the Wu Xing, her elemental aptitude most apparent within in combat situations.

Weapons:
  • Personal Grimoire: A tome infused with her own magic power, it is used to amplify spells. It is heavily enchanted, granting it immense durability, and preventing anyone else from reading from its pages or benefiting from its ability of amplification. A single amethyst is embedded into the cover of the tome.
  • “Diary”: A heavily bound book that acts as a personal journal used to take notes, keep logs, illustrate sigils as well as to construct runes.
  • Moon Crescent: A yellow curve of shaped metal that takes it place upon her attire. The ordainment acts as a symbol of knowledge and purity.
  • Spell Card Deck: A 'deck' of magically infused cards on which are depicted the required magical incantations to enchant the unique spell engraved upon it.
Weaknesses: Patchouli’s devotion to her study within the library has rendered her mentally strong, but at the cost of her physical strength and endurance. Her vigil within the library has resulted in the rapid deterioration of her physical form and general poor health. She is plagued with physical ailments such as asthma and anemia, causing further damage to her already weakened form. While this has irrefutably weakened her constitution, her innate durability she retains from her powers and race still allows her to receive attacks that would otherwise destroy lesser beings.

Appearance: Patchouli's attire consists almost explicitly of nightwear, the girl’s nightgown worn as everyday attire, her nightcap matching the lavender coloration of her gown, a single crescent moon medallion affixed to her headwear. Affixed to various parts of her attire are a plethora of red and blue ribbons, many of which utilized to control the long violet hair the girl possesses. The girl’s fair complexion and purple eyes do little to heighten the stoic expression that is usually spread across her face, yet none so much so as her diminutive size, the meager witch miniature nigh to the point of frailty, her short height and lithe form comparable to that of a child’s, stealing away the seriousness usually afforded to scholars of her caliber.


Personality: Difficult to read and impossible to interpret, Patchouli is an introvert who’s cold actions and equally frigid demeanor leads the reserved and taciturn witch further into self-imposed isolation. Quiet around others, she retains a somber means of self-expression through which she broods through whatever social interaction she is forced to endure; quick to the point, and even faster to end the engagement, the girl hardly acts beyond what is required to achieve what she so desires – as such, any such social proposition she herself proposes is certainly a means to her end.

Morality: Unaligned - Taking a pick of neither ‘good’ nor ‘evil’, Patchouli simply exists to serve her knowledge hungry whims, any and all attempts to sooth her insatiable hunger made without seeing the moral nor ethical titles associated to her actions. Neither is the witch willing to support the balance of law or chaos, or the lack thereof past the confines of her own domain.

Biography: Patchouli Knowledge, the ‘Enigmatic Source of Magic’, librarian of the Scarlet Devil Mansion and peerless master of the arcane; truly in her life did she accomplish what countless others before her had only dreamt of, her existence as a witch augmented by the very reality around her after having spent the entirety of her life pursuing exactly what she yearned for the most, knowledge and understanding of the unknown. But all things even the gods have an origin, do they not?

Even as a child Patchouli was remarkably intuitive, the young Knowledge spending the early legs of her life perched wherever she could clasp her tender young hands about the bindings of whatever text she could scavenge, such insatiable pursuits the cause of many disciplinary actions taken against the young girl. That however is a story of another life, a life before the girl’s indoctrination into Gensokyo; what is significant of this tale is that the girl, much like many of the others who inevitably coalesced to populate the lands of Gensokyo, had found herself born into a world that would much rather do without her existence, a world that rejected magic and the old belief of witchcraft. So Patchouli fled the world she knew seeking asylum within the then establishing boundaries of Gensokyo, a place that welcome what had been rejected by worlds parallel. Yet the tender young witch would not be alone in her journey for asylum.

Patchouli’s relationship with Remilia Scarlet has long been a source of discrepancy and debate, the bond between the two ''close friends' described as a long held friendship; but for how long this ‘friendship’ has existed or how the two met remains a mystery to the common eye - however what is understood is that neither of these 'friends' could be considered natives to the realm of Gensokyo. Remilia’s appearance alongside her sister’s, Flandre, shrouded in the unknown; matching the sudden and unexplained materialization of the Scarlet Devil Manor at the edge of the land’s renown Misty Lake, the two of which who readily inhabited the estate despite it’s ominous existence. Whilst it is difficult to accurately pinpoint Patchouli’s initial appearance within the realm of Gensokyo due to her overtly reclusive nature, it is stipulated that Patchouli has inhabited the manor for just as long as Remilia; perhaps forging such a relationship with the manor's mistress before fleeing alongside the Scarlet Sisters to Gensokyo. Regardless of the disorienting allure that surrounded Patchouli’s appearance within Gensokyo, the budding witch found herself residing within the halls of the Scarlet Devil Manor, the witch free to practice under the shelter of her mistress and the enchanting realm of Gensokyo.

It was here within the Scarlet Devil Mansion that Patchouli spent the grand majority of her life, dedicated to the endless pursuit of arcane mastery. Yet this pursuit was not made possible without the estate’s illustrious library, promptly dubbed Voile by it's newfound master, Patchouli would make full usage of it’s exhaustive content of arcane texts, their existence paramount to the development and advancement of the witch. It was within the dark recesses of Voile that Patchouli’s mind expanded, worlds unvisited explored, secrets of the occult unraveled, all of this and more revealed to the witch as she immersed herself within the library’s knowledge, the mind of the girl maturing, even as her ageless form resisted the onslaught of time.

A century would pass in such a way, Patchouli’s endless study and exploration of the occult a reliable constant within the chaotic realm of Gensoyko, the witch would grow to surpass previous confines, the expanded mind of the girl sharp enhanced by her studies and empowered by the arcane. Even as her vigil within the confines of Voile had expanded the girl’s mind beyond untold limits a debilitating blow was struck; Patchouli's body withered within the corruptive halls of Voile, the polluted library stealing away at the girl's physical existence just as prolifically as it had added to her mental. Feeble even in comparison to that of a human’s physicality, Patchouli was further weakened by her development of such diseases as anemia and asthma, the girl’s physical constitution robbed from her in exchange for her ill-gotten mastery over the arcane.

Patchouli’s search into the arcane was limitless, the mind of the knowledge hungry girl flourishing within the halls of Voile, whilst her body withered away, neglected in the girl’s fevered search of the unknown. The halls of Voile welcomed it’s familiar master, providing for Patchouli’s every source of knowledge, yet, even this cycle would inevitably come to an end. . .

Plucked from the world of Gensokyo the solitary witch would be thrust into the world of man, a world unfamiliar in a dimension hence unknown to the girl, leaving her with newfound struggles within the war torn Earth inhabited nigh solely by humanity.

Traumas: While Patchouli has never endured a particularly traumatic event she does long to return to her world, breaking down into desperation when her efforts to return are challenged or proven futile.
